Cost of Living FAQs

Is it cheaper to rent or buy in Yalobusha County?

Based on median housing data, renting is currently more affordable on a monthly basis in Yalobusha County. The estimated all-in monthly cost for renting is $855, while owning a median-priced home with a 20% down payment is roughly $1,010 per month (a difference of $155).

How much do utilities cost in Yalobusha County?

The average monthly utility cost (electricity and natural gas) for a typical home in Yalobusha County is approximately $203. This estimate uses local utility rate schedules combined with median energy consumption profiles.

What is a good salary to live comfortably in Yalobusha County?

To comfortably afford the median rent and utilities in Yalobusha County without exceeding the recommended 30% housing-to-income threshold, a household should earn a gross salary of approximately $34,200 per year.
